We are seeking a proactive and detail-oriented Business Continuity Officer to join a busy and high-performing operational team. This role is key to ensuring effective response to incidents and supporting the ongoing development of business continuity and resilience practices. We are looking for someone who can remain calm under pressure and is confident working in a fast-paced, incident-driven environment.

You will play a hands-on role in coordinating responses to operational incidents, while also providing expert advice and guidance to stakeholders across the organisation.

Key Responsibilities
  • Lead response to Bronze-level business continuity incidents, ensuring effective coordination and timely resolution
  • Support senior managers in handling Silver and Gold-level incidents
  • Provide expert advice and guidance on business continuity to internal stakeholders
  • Assist with the development, maintenance, and improvement of business continuity plans and processes
  • Support compliance with business continuity standards (e.g. ISO 22301)
  • Produce clear, accurate reports and documentation
  • Maintain and update records using systems such as SharePoint or other document management tools
Essential Experience & Skills
  • Proven experience supporting or managing business continuity or operational incidents
  • Experience working with senior stakeholders and providing advice or guidance
  • Strong organisational skills with the ability to manage multiple priorities
  • Excellent written communication and report-writing skills
  • High attention to detail and accuracy
  • Comfortable using Microsoft Office and document management systems
Desirable
  • Experience working with business continuity frameworks (e.g. ISO 22301)
  • Background in risk, resilience, or operational continuity environments
